"Llanddewi Brefi on Saturday enjoyed one of the few sunny days during August which added to the cheerful atmosphere of this typical 'Cardi' meeting. With £1000 on offer to the winner of the Grade A final the racing lived up to the expectations for a classic event.
The Nursery kicked off proceedings with a win for the youngster Sunnyside Geoff belonging to new owners the Clarke family from Brecon but driven by his experienced trainer Andrew Hardwick also from Brecon, in second was local horse the Talgarreg based Glan Dancer (H Evans) with Radnor Halleluliah and Andrew Bevan from Builth in third.
The first novice heat gave a win for the big hearted grey Ayr Force One (Haslam Llanybydder) and young Emma Langford from Pontardawe with Sam the Man (Tromans Newcastle Emlyn) in second and little Katie Blue (Williams Shrewsbury) in third. Newly promoted My Immortal and his young owner / driver Mark Evans from Brecon took the honours in the second heat beating Classic Day (Miles Merthyr) and Coalford Time (Hardwick Brecon).
The in form Hitchcock stable from Haverfordwest sent out the winner of the first Grade B heat, Chinatown Maori (Jones Llanllwni) on his first open run with Blackfield Willy (Barton Clunderwen) in second and Wellfield Xpense (Langford Ludlow) third. Bon Beti (Evans Jones Rhymney) ran an impressive race in the second heat to win from Meadowbranch Mike (Jones Llanllwni) and Gangster (Evans Brecon).
Three Grade A heats followed with gate horse Vodka Express (Weigel Llanddewi Velfrey) taking the first from back marker the flying grey Live the Dream (Langford Pontardawe) while Master T J (Gwatkin Evenjobb) was third. The little chestnut mare Believe (Crowther Llanidloes) won the second heat beating Ithon Ace (Williams Shrewsbury) and Blackbird (Lloyd Kington). Bon Bethan (Weigel Llanddewi Velfrey) continued her sensational season to win the third heat for her young driver Louisa Myers with the back marker Purple Rain (Edwards Bromfield) in second and Fold Surprise (Perks Presteigne) in third.
Emma Langford picked up another drive in the first Baby Novice race as she partnered Ithon Artist (Wozencraft Llangurig) to a win from Man of the Day (Harries Llanllwni) and Fold Tinto (Perks Presteigne). In the second Baby Novice Highbrooks Teebeau driven by part owner & trainer Mathew Williams won while Saunders Playboy (Pritchard Rhosgoch) was second and Today's Future (Hughes Builth Road) was third. C U Boykin (Hitchcock Haverfordwest) claimed his ticket into the Novice section by winning the last Baby Novice race beating long time leader Hilltop Polly (Gittins Welshpool) and newly purchased Ithon Eagle (Edwards Bromfield).
The dash produced the closest finish of the day with a nose dividing Family Circle (Barton Clunderwen) driven by Louisa Myers as they defied what looked like certain victory for Obi-Wan-Kenobi (Williams Llanafan) with Blackbird (Lloyd Kington) running on to be third.
In the Novice final the hard pulling home-bred Classic Day (Miles Merthyr) registered a fine win driven by young Rebecca Williams who works in a National hunt stable in Shropshire with My Immortal (Evans Brecon) relegated to second and Ayr Force One (Haslam Llanybydder) third. Unfortunately Chinatown Maori had to withdraw from the Grade B final because of lameness but his stable companion Meadowbranch Mike (Jones Llanllwni) driven as usual by trainer Debbie Hitchcock admirably deputised by winning from the often placed Blackfield Willy (Barton Clunderwen) and the much improved Gangster (Evans Brecon). The premiere race of the day was the Grade A final when the little chestnut mare Believe (Crowther Llanidloes) battled to the front for leading driver Derek Pritchard with stable companions Vodka Express and Bon Bethan both belonging to the Weigel family from Llanddewi Velfrey securing second and third.
The final race of the day was the Junior race where the experienced Bethan Perks on Fold Rajah (Perks Presteigne) made up a long trail to claim a close victory from this season's new-comer Daisy Cornes driving Hilltop Polly (Gittins Welshpool).
